Abstract
Singapore enjoys the advantages of a conscientious and highly skilled workforce in the service and manufacturing software industries. Government institutions such as the National Computer Board (NCB) and the Ministry of Defense (MINDEF) have highly qualified in-house software support and development personnel. The majority of software developed in Singapore in the commercial sector is applications software. However, in the commercial sector, the software development industry is still in its infancy. Although multinational companies such as Hewlett-Packard have started to establish research and development centres in Singapore, the country must still overcome various obstacles before software development meets international standards
